WebIf you want to jump to a specific hour, open the console, then type: set gamehour to (number) The number will be between 0 and 24. So if you want noon, type: set gamehour to 12 And if you want 11pm, type: set gamehour to 23 Setting the weather is annoying because you pretty much have to look up the weather’s ID on the wiki. WebWell the default ratio is 1:20, so for every minute that passes in real life, 20 minutes pass in Skyrim. You can set the 20 to whatever you feel most comfortable with. Some people say to not set the timescale to lower than 6 because of potential buggy quests, others have said they've had full playthroughs with no errors at all.

WebFeb 27, 2012 · You can just open the console with TILDE ~ and type. set timescale to x. Where x is the ratio of 1 real-time minute to in-game time. By default, the value is 20 where 1 real-time minute is equivalent to 20 in-game minutes. You only need to enter this once and save and the setting is stored for that particular save profile onwards.
